Are you a recent Science graduate looking to gain hands-on experience in education? Do you have a passion for inspiring young minds and supporting the next generation of scientists?
We are working with dynamic and inclusive primary schools across South Manchester who are seeking motivated Science graduates to join their support teams this September 2026. This is a fantastic opportunity for those considering a career in teaching or educational psychology.
As a Science Graduate Support Assistant, you will:
Work alongside experienced science teachers to support students in lessons and practical's
Provide 1:1 and small group interventions to boost engagement and understanding
Help prepare materials and equipment for experiments
Inspire students to develop a love of learning and curiosity in science
Support classroom management and contribute to a positive learning environment
A recent graduate in a science-related discipline (Biology, Chemistry, Physics or a related field)
Enthusiastic, reliable, and eager to learn
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
Experience working with young people (e.g. tutoring, mentoring, volunteering) is a plus but not essential
